Goals:

The purpose of this course is to: Familiarize students with the basic bookkeeping fundamentals for managing both a personal/service-type business and a merchandising business. Introduce students to a popular bookkeeping software, Quickbooks, used by many small businesses Introduce students to double-entry bookkeeping, the foundation for further accounting study.

Reinforce students' learning through online tests, excel spreadsheet submissions, and hands-on experience with Quickbooks. At the end of this course, the student should be able to: Understand the basic bookkeeping equations and all supporting journals, ledgers, and worksheets. Set up Quickbooks, enter data accurately, and manage the bookkeeping function for a small business. Explain and utilize double-entry accounting by understanding the impacts of debits and credits for all account types.

Instructor Bio: Ronald Brown

Ronald Brown brings forth over 15 years experience in the Business Accounting field. His previous opportunities include Assistant Account Manager for a multi-million dollar hotel chain where he managed the Night Auditors as well as sales revenue. He has also served as the Maintenance Account Specialist for Southland Corporation and was primarily responsible for overseeing 600 store maintenance contracts.

Currently, Ronald is a Staff Accountant for Condumex Inc and Porcelanite Tile Company. He manages all asset accounts dealing with 16 banks and 4 investment accounts for both companies combined. He oversees the Germany, China and Laredo, TX daily cash flow for operations as well as the monthly accounting closing procedure for AP, AR and inventory for both companies. Ronald Brown graduated from Panola Junior College with an Associate of Science Degree in Business Administration / Accounting Major. He also earned a Bachelor of Business Administration degree in Management from Northwood University.
